BARNET EDUCATION ARTS TRUST 

Barnet Education Arts Trust provides music education opportunities to young people living in or attending school in the London Borough of Barnet. Occasionally these opportunities may extend to neighbouring boroughs. The activities include lessons, ensembles, workshops and performances
Analysis by Giving is Great

Positives:

  • There have been no material income shortfalls in recent years
  • Fundraising costs are unusually low relative to funds raised
  • A significant proportion of recent income was derived from major grant makers including the Government
  • The Board appears to be well diversified in terms of age and gender and dynamic in terms of composition

Regulatory & Governance issues to consider:

  • This charity is not recognised by HMRC for Gift Aid according to its latest published return
  • Although this charity works with volunteers it does not have a Volunteer Management policy
